I am using Word 2002 running over Windows XP. All service packs for Word,
(Office) & XP are current. My issue is the display of images w/in Word.
Whether I insert them or paste, or paste special; they do not display in Page
layout, or any other view. If I click the general area of where the image
should be, ( as indicated the the large blank area), I can see the grid
outline display. More often then not the images will display in print preview
& they always pint correctly.
I have unchecked Picture Placeholders & the format is set to “inline w/Textâ€
Frankly I am at a loss & attempting to distribute documents to my team
partners while we collaborate on a new software development project has
become maddening.

Video driver?
Try this, control panel, display folder, settings tab, advanced button, troubleshoot
tab. Slide the acceleration down on your adapter.
If this works go to the manufacturer's web site and look around for an upgraded video
driver

You are my new best friend! I did as you suggested lowering the accelerator
setting and it resolved the issue. I then went out to the Intell site and
updated the driver and now everything works beautifully, (of course everyone
else on the team has to update their machine, but that is a very small
price).
